Willy's actions in Arthur Miller's "Death of a Salesman" are believably motivated by his deep-seated desire for success and validation, both for himself and his family. His relentless pursuit of the American Dream, coupled with his insecurities and disillusionment, drives him to make choices that often seem irrational. Additionally, his longing for connection and fear of failure contribute to his tragic decisions, making his motivations relatable and complex. Ultimately, Willy embodies the struggles of many individuals facing societal pressures and personal aspirations.

Profit-motivated refers to actions or decisions made primarily to generate financial gain or increase earnings. This concept is commonly associated with businesses and investors who prioritize maximizing profits over other factors, such as social responsibility or environmental concerns. In a profit-motivated context, the primary goal is to enhance revenue and reduce costs to achieve the highest possible financial return.

Yes, Reverend Dimmesdale's actions in "The Scarlet Letter" are believably motivated. His internal struggle with guilt, societal expectations, and his love for Hester Prynne drive him to conceal his sin and suffer in silence. His complex character and conflicting emotions make his actions realistic and compelling.

Hamlet's actions may appear to be irrational or erratic, but they are often motivated by his desire to seek justice for his father's murder and his struggle with moral dilemmas. It is debatable whether his actions truly indicate insanity or if they are a result of his complex emotional state and circumstances.
